State Farm Insurance — A Little History

State Farm got its start in 1922 in Bloomington, IL, when Jacob “G.J.” Mecherle founded it as an auto insurer. Nearly a century later, it’s grown into one of the most recognizable names in insurance — a mutual company owned by its own policyholders, with a whole family of subsidiaries under the State Farm name. That includes a Florida-only property arm, State Farm Florida Insurance Company, which is the one that actually issues your homeowners policy here.

A fun bit of trivia while we’re here: a young Barry Manilow wrote the “Like a Good Neighbor” jingle back in 1971, long before he was a household name himself. Jake from State Farm showed up decades later, in 2011.

Is State Farm Still Writing New Homeowners Policies in Florida?

Technically, yes. But don’t assume that means your home qualifies. For families in Brandon, Valrico, and Riverview shopping for coverage, new business goes through State Farm Florida Insurance Company, and they’re being selective about who they take on. They tend to favor:

  • Homes further inland, away from coastal and barrier-island ZIP codes (especially in Monroe County)
  • Roofs under about 15 years old
  • Homes built after 2001, once Florida’s stronger building code kicked in
  • A clean claims history

If your home doesn’t check those boxes — maybe it’s closer to the coast, or the roof has some years on it, or it was built before the code changed — there’s a good chance State Farm will pass, even while technically still “writing” in Florida. Can You Trust State Farm’s Financial Strength?

Short answer: yes, but it depends which part of State Farm you’re actually asking about, since AM Best rates them separately:

  • State Farm Florida Insurance Company — the one protecting your home — carries an A- (Excellent) rating, and its outlook was just upgraded to stable in the most recent AM Best rating action on November 14, 2025.
  • State Farm Mutual — the national parent that handles auto insurance — was downgraded to A+ (Superior) from A++ that same day, after years of underwriting pressure across the industry.

Both companies are still solidly rated, and your Florida homeowners policy gets extra backing from the parent company’s reinsurance and capital support. Ratings can shift over time, so it’s always worth double-checking with your agent before you buy.
